How to fill out natural shoreland erosion control

01
Identify the specific areas along the shoreland that are experiencing erosion.
02
Determine the cause of the erosion, such as wave action, ice movement, or water flow.
03
Assess the severity of the erosion and the potential for further damage.
04
Consult with a landscape professional or erosion control specialist to develop a plan for natural shoreland erosion control.
05
Implement erosion control measures such as planting native vegetation, installing erosion control blankets or mats, and creating rock or vegetated buffers.
06
Monitor the effectiveness of the erosion control methods and make necessary adjustments.
07
Regularly maintain the erosion control measures to ensure their long-term effectiveness.

Natural shoreland erosion control refers to the use of natural materials and techniques to mitigate erosion along shorelines, protecting land and water resources.
Individuals or organizations that undertake certain activities that may affect the shoreline, such as construction or vegetation removal, are typically required to file for natural shoreland erosion control.
To fill out natural shoreland erosion control, applicants should obtain the necessary forms from local regulatory authorities and provide all required information about the project, including location and methods planned for erosion control.
The purpose of natural shoreland erosion control is to prevent soil erosion, protect water quality, enhance natural habitats, and maintain the ecological balance of shorelines.
The information reported must include project details, location, methods of erosion control, potential impacts, and mitigation measures.
